Mysql trigger 简单问题,请教大神
发布网友
发布时间:2023-02-15 13:30
我来回答
共1个回答
热心网友
时间:2023-09-14 18:56
DELIMITER
//
CREATE
TRIGGER
tir_dep_insert
AFTER
INSERT
ON
empdep
FOR
EACH
ROW
BEGIN
UPDATE
empfo
SET
depid
=
new.depid,
depname
=
new.depnme
WHERE
id
=
new.id
;
END//
MySQL
存储过程,
要先调用
DELIMITER
,
设定另外一种符号
作为
语句的
"终止符号"
因为
mysql
默认是以
分号
;
作为语句的终止符号了。
如果没有定义的话,
那么遇到的第一个
分号,
mysql
就认为语句执行结束了。
另外
没见过
inserted